科目名稱(chēng) 高級語(yǔ)言程序設計 編號 828
考試專(zhuān)業(yè) 1405智能科學(xué)與技術(shù)
一、考試性質(zhì)
本考試大綱適用于報考湖北民族大學(xué)智能科學(xué)與技術(shù)專(zhuān)業(yè)的碩士研究生入學(xué)考試?!陡呒壵Z(yǔ)言程序設計》不僅是大學(xué)本科智能科學(xué)類(lèi)專(zhuān)業(yè)的專(zhuān)業(yè)基礎課,也是其他從事智能算法、智能控制等方向一門(mén)重要的基礎課程?!陡呒壵Z(yǔ)言程序設計》科目要求考生系統掌握程序設計的基本知識、基礎技能和結構化程序設計的方法,并能運用相關(guān)理論和算法分析、解決實(shí)際問(wèn)題?!陡呒壵Z(yǔ)言程序設計》科目重點(diǎn)考查考生利用C語(yǔ)言進(jìn)行常用算法理解和應用編程的能力。
二、考核目標
《高級語(yǔ)言程序設計》試卷旨在考查考生對C語(yǔ)言程序設計基本知識、基本理論的掌握,注重考查考生熟練運用結構化程序設計的三種基本結構編寫(xiě)程序和熟練掌握函數、數組、指針等知識點(diǎn)綜合應用的能力。
具體要求如下:
1. 掌握常量、變量、數據類(lèi)型、表達式、算法與流程圖等基本概念。
2. 掌握輸入、輸出等基本語(yǔ)句及簡(jiǎn)單程序設計。
3. 掌握順序、選擇、循環(huán)三種程序結構及其應用。
4. 掌握數組、字符串及其應用。
5. 掌握函數(子程序、方法)及其應用。
6. 掌握指針及其應用。
三、考試形式與試卷結構
1. 考試時(shí)間:考試時(shí)間為180分鐘,3小時(shí)。
2. 試卷滿(mǎn)分:本試卷滿(mǎn)分為150分。
3. 考試形式:閉卷、筆試。
4.試卷內容結構:選擇題30分,簡(jiǎn)答題30分,程序分析題30分,程序設計題60分。
四、考試內容
1. 程序設計和 C 語(yǔ)言
要求掌握程序的構成、main 函數和其他函數、頭文件、數據說(shuō)明、函數的開(kāi)始和結束標志以及程序中的注釋。要點(diǎn)是在理解C語(yǔ)言程序構成的基礎上掌握源程序的書(shū)寫(xiě)格式。
2. 順序程序設計
要求掌握 C 語(yǔ)言的基本數據類(lèi)型;掌握 C 語(yǔ)言標識符的構成規則,定義變量、符號常量的方法;掌握 C 語(yǔ)言的基本運算符、及運算優(yōu)先級和結合性;掌握不同類(lèi)型數據間的轉換規則,包括隱式類(lèi)型轉換、強制類(lèi)型轉換,掌握表達式的概念;能夠準確的判斷表達式的結果類(lèi)型和值,特別是賦值表達式、自加自減表達式、逗號表達式、問(wèn)號表達式的使用;掌握C語(yǔ)言語(yǔ)句的構成,表達式語(yǔ)句,空語(yǔ)句,復合語(yǔ)句;掌握輸入輸出函數的調用,正確輸入數據并正確設計輸出格式。要點(diǎn)是利用C語(yǔ)言能夠按照順序程序設計要求理解算法,并能夠針對實(shí)際問(wèn)題設計算法。
3. 選擇結構程序設計
要求掌握關(guān)系表達式和邏輯表達式的使用方法;掌握選擇結構,包括 if、if…else、if…else if 結構的使用;以及 if 結構的嵌套;switch 結構的使用。要點(diǎn)是利用C語(yǔ)言能夠按照選擇結構程序設計要求理解算法,并能夠針對實(shí)際問(wèn)題設計算法。
4. 循環(huán)結構程序設計
要求掌握基本循環(huán)結構的使用,包括 while、do…while、for 三種結構,以及它們的區別;掌握 break、continue 的使用;掌握循環(huán)嵌套。要點(diǎn)是能夠利用C語(yǔ)言按照多重循環(huán)結構理解算法,并能夠針對實(shí)際問(wèn)題設計算法。
5. 利用數組處理批量數據
要求掌握一維數組和二維數組的定義、初始化和數組元素的引用;掌握字符串與字符數組的處理。要點(diǎn)是能夠利用C語(yǔ)言針對實(shí)際應用問(wèn)題設計和處理數組和字符串。
6. 用函數實(shí)現模塊化程序設計
要求掌握函數的聲明、定義、調用;理解函數的調用過(guò)程;掌握函數形參與實(shí)參的概念,理解參數的傳遞過(guò)程:掌握傳值的參數傳遞方式;掌握函數的嵌套調用,遞歸調用;掌握變量的生存期與作用域,包括局部變量和全局變量,以及 auto、 static、extern 變量。要點(diǎn)是能夠利用C語(yǔ)言和模塊化編程思想設計解決實(shí)際復雜工程問(wèn)題和算法。
7. 善于利用指針
要求理解指針的含義。掌握指針的相關(guān)運算,包括&、*、+、- 等;掌握指針和數組的關(guān)系。包括一維數組、二維數組的地址法訪(fǎng)問(wèn)、指針數組、數組指針。要點(diǎn)是在C語(yǔ)言環(huán)境下能夠正確理解算法中的指針,并能夠使用指針解決實(shí)際工程問(wèn)題。
五、參考書(shū)目
《C 程序設計(第五版)》,譚浩強,清華大學(xué)出版社,2017年。
原標題:2025年全國碩士研究生招生考試(初試)湖北民族大學(xué)自命題科目考試大綱
文章來(lái)源:https://www.hbmzu.edu.cn/yjsc/info/1005/1894.htm